如何檢索詩詞(古詩詞查詢器)
大家好,今天來為大家解答關于如何檢索詩詞這個問題的知識,還有對于古詩詞查詢器也是一樣,很多人還不知道是什么意思,今天就讓我來為大家分享這個問題,現在讓我們一起來看看吧!
如何查找古詩詞
找一個古詩詞網站,例如:
您只要輸入詩詞句的關鍵字、或詩詞名、或作者,就可以尋找到自己所需的古詩詞。
古詩詞檢測小程序有哪些
古詩詞檢測小程序有:
1、我愛讀詩詞。可以查詢唐詩宋詞,各個朝代的,有賞析,注釋,解釋。
2、古詩詞查詢小程序,里邊有詩詞文2萬首左右。
3、漢語詩詞寶典小程序提供古詩詞內容檢索,唐詩三百首,宋詞三百首,小學生必背古詩詞,古詩詞翻譯、注釋、賞析。
如何從一個數據集按照關鍵詞快速檢索詩詞?
對于數據集按照關鍵詞快速檢索功能性需求大致要考慮以下幾點:
數據是格式化的還是非格式化數據?要構建索引的原始數據,類型很多。我把它分為兩類,一類是結構化數據,比如MySQL中的數據;另一類是非結構化數據,比如搜索引擎中的網頁。對于非結構化數據,我們一般需要做預處理,提取出查詢關鍵詞,對關鍵詞構建索引。
數據是靜態數據還是動態數據?如果原始是一組靜態數據,也就是說,不會有數據的增加、刪除、更新操作,所以,我們在構建索引的時候,只需要考慮查詢效率就可以了。這樣,索引的構建就相對簡單些。不過,大部分情況下,我們都是對動態數據構建索引,也就是說,我們不僅要考慮到索引的查詢效率,在原始數據更新時,我們還需要動態的更新索引。支持動態數據集合的索引,設計越來相對更復雜些。
索引是存儲在內存還是硬盤?如果索引存儲在內存中,那技術要求的速度肯定要比存儲的磁盤中的高。但是,如果原始數據量很大的情況下,對應的索引可能也會很大。這個時候,因為內存有限,我們可能就不得不將索引存儲在硬盤中了。實際上,還有第三種情況,那就是一部分存儲在內存,一部分存儲在磁盤,這樣就可以兼顧內存消耗和查詢效率。
單值查找還是區間查找?所謂單值查找,也就是根據查詢關鍵詞等于某個值的數據。這種查詢需求最常見。所謂區間查找,就是查找關鍵詞處于某個區間值的所有數據。實際上,不同的應用場景,查詢的需求會多種多樣。
單關鍵詞查找還是多關鍵詞組合查找?比如,搜索引擎中構建的索引,既要支持一個關鍵詞的查找,比如“數據結構”,也要支持組合關鍵詞查找,比如“數據結構 AND算法”。對于單關鍵詞查找,索引構建起來相對簡單些。對于多關鍵詞查找來說,要分多種情況。像MySQL這種結構化數據的查詢需求,我們可以實現針對多個關鍵詞組合,建立索引;對于像搜索引擎這樣的非結構數據的查詢需求,我們可以針對間個關鍵詞構建索引,然后通過集合操作,比如求并集、求交集等,計算出多個關鍵詞組合的查詢結果。
實際上,不同的場景,不同的原始數據,對于索引的需求也會千差萬別。
如何檢索詩詞的介紹就聊到這里吧,感謝你花時間閱讀本站內容,更多關于古詩詞查詢器、如何檢索詩詞的信息別忘了在本站進行查找喔。
版權聲明:本站發布此文出于傳遞更多信息之目的,并不代表本站贊同其觀點和對其真實性負責,請讀者僅作參考,并請自行核實相關內容。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。